This week was the third annual "Apple Friday" for our GHHS Marching Band members! GHBOB parents Andy and Jenni Betz, both alums of the Gallia Academy high school marching band, have brought this tradition to us from their own high school years. When they were in school, once every season, a local family picked apples and brought them to share with the marching band as a way to say thanks to our students for all the hard work they put in creating entertaining shows for the fans and energetic support for the football team. The Betz family now does that for our marching Bobcats, and our students have started looking forward to this tradition and asking about it at the beginning of every year!
You can enjoy a few photos below from Apple Friday and the accompanying football game - a 35-0 pasting of our crosstown rivals from Bexley HS. And click here for some video! Big thanks to the Betz family for the sweet fruity treat and recognition of our band's hard work.
